Capitals Daily Report: Carlson’s Back

tj-oshie-washington-capitals-caps-practice-kettler-jpgThe Capitals returned to the Kettler ice this afternoon for the first time since the All Star break . There was already some news this morning as two players were recalled from Hershey. John Carlson also returned to action as the team gets ready for what promises to be an exciting second half of the season. Tomorrow they’ll face the Islanders in Brooklyn. 

PRACTICE
Alex Ovechkin and Braden Holtby weren’t at practice today. They’re traveling back from LA from the All Star weekend festivities. John Carlson was back on the ice after he missed nearly two weeks of play with a lower body injury.

Christian Djoos and Chandler Stephenson were recalled from Hershey this morning. This was Djoos first time practicing with the big boys.

With Ovechkin absent, Stephenson took over for him on the top line while Brett Leonhardt, the team’s video coach, took over for Holtby.

Trotz said after practice that there’s a chance Carlson is going to play tomorrow night against the Islanders and that if he doesn’t play tomorrow, he will on Wednesday against the Bruins. Trotz also said that Philipp Grubauer will start in goal tomorrow night.

SHAVINGS

  • Chandler Stephenson has earned 24 points (6 goals, 18 assists) in 41 games with Hershey this season and ranks fifth on the team in assists and tied for sixth in points.
  • Christian Djoos has earned 26 points (5 goals, 21 assists) in 35 games with Hershey this season and ranks third on the team in assists and fifth in points.
  • Djoos leads all Bears defensemen in points and assists while being tied for first in goals.
